Windows中如何实现python程序开机自启
时间: 2024-04-08 21:36:12 浏览: 71
要在 Windows 中实现 Python 程序的开机自启动,可以通过以下两种方法来实现:
方法一:使用注册表编辑器(Registry Editor)
1. 打开注册表编辑器,可以通过按下 `Win + R` 键,输入 `regedit`,然后点击确定来打开。
2. 在注册表编辑器中,导航到以下路径:`HKEY_CURRENT_USER\Software\Microsoft\Windows\CurrentVersion\Run`。
3. 在右侧窗格中,右键单击空白处,选择“新建” -> “字符串值”。
4. 为新建的字符串值指定一个名称,例如 `MyPythonScript`。
5. 双击新建的字符串值,将其数值数据设置为你要启动的 Python 脚本的完整路径(包括 `.py` 文件)。
方法二:使用启动文件夹(Startup Folder)
1. 按下 `Win + R` 键,输入 `shell:startup`,然后点击确定来打开启动文件夹。
2. 在启动文件夹中,右键单击空白处,选择“新建” -> “快捷方式”。
3. 在弹出的“创建快捷方式”对话框中,输入你要启动的 Python 脚本的完整路径(包括 `.py` 文件)。
4. 点击“下一步”并按照提示完成创建快捷方式的过程。
无论使用哪种方法,确保设置的路径是正确的,并且你的 Python 程序可以从该路径运行。在下次启动电脑时,Windows 将自动运行你指定的 Python 程序。
请注意,以上方法是针对当前用户的开机自启动。如果你想要实现系统级别的开机自启动,可以改为在以下路径中进行设置:`HKEY_LOCAL_MACHINE\Software\Microsoft\Windows\CurrentVersion\Run` 或 `C:\ProgramData\Microsoft\Windows\Start Menu\Programs\StartUp`。但在修改系统级别的设置时,需要以管理员身份运行注册表编辑器或访问启动文件夹。
阅读全文